Course overview

The Hypothalamus-Anterior Pituitary-Adrenal Cortex (HPA) axis has been a cornerstone in understanding mental health. Therefore, this course will review the evidence provided by research and teach participants how to integrate it into their practice. Areas of focus for the course will include the neurological and physiological impacts of each part of the HPA axis. Thus, the interactions between each part of the HPA axis will be taught. In addition, most of the material will be focused on giving the clinicals the tools to be able to provide psychoeducation to clients on the subject while avoiding confusion or patronization. The clinical use of analogy, visual handouts, and videos will be completed. Course Objectives: Identify the function of each piece of the HPA axis. Explain the interactions between the HPA axis including negative feedback. Provide psychoeducation on the HPA axis in verbal or visual format.
